If you have ever donated blood or had your blood tested, you've gotten a peek of what phlebotomists do. Lab's use phlebotomists to gather quality blood samples from patients and produce reliable test result in the lab--from toxin screenings and cholesterol counts, to evaluations for viruses and bacterial diseases. To be skillful with taking samples requires many hours of exercise. The training program selected should offer 50 to 100 hours in clinical practice. As your phlebotomy training advances, it is strongly recommended that students enter into an internship program to receive valuable hands on experience by means of a community clinic, physician's office or hospital. Phlebotomists are trained in drawing blood from a vein. Blood collection must occur in a safe and sterile environment.
